First Project:

I want to use 3/4 oz for the outside and kid or pig inside. The inside will be glued. I want to wet form this after it is done without any stain/antique or sealer finish. Will the liner detach from the outside if it is soaked in water? If it will, describe a better way.

While writing this I suppose I could wet form it before stitching and then add the lining, but I want a tight fit, it won't have a strap to keep it in the case.

I would wet mold both the outside and the liner separately and then glue them together.

Alternatively you could wet mold the outside and do a french turned binding with the liner.

Like this knife sheath...https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=yZKxHdNIiP4

EDIT: If you wet form the lining separately from the outside make sure to put the lining so the flesh side is facing outward or else it will come out backwards.
